Enable job alerts via email!

Hiring in Canada: Senior Web Application Developer

Flynn Group of Companies

Canada

Remote

CAD 90,000 - 120,000

Full time

Today
Be an early applicant

Job summary

A leading building envelope contractor is seeking a Senior Web Application Developer for their Toronto office. The ideal candidate will have over 10 years of experience and a strong background in .NET and C#. The role offers permanent relocation to Canada and includes benefits like accommodation and health insurance.

Benefits

3 months accommodation
Reimbursement for flight to Canada
Health Insurance
Dental and vision plans
Registered Retirement Savings Plan contributions

Qualifications

  • 10+ years of recent experience in software development.
  • Minimum 5 years in a Sr. Web Developer or similar senior role.
  • Basic networking knowledge and troubleshooting required.

Responsibilities

  • Design, architect, develop, and test key applications.
  • Mentor other developers in best practices.
  • Participate in a rotating weekly on-call schedule.

Skills

.NET / .NET Framework
C#
TypeScript
Angular
MySQL
MongoDB
Docker
Jira

Education

Post-secondary education in Computer Science/IT or related field

Tools

AWS ECS
Azure DevOps
Job description
Overview

Flynn Group of Companies, North America’s leading building envelope contractor, is looking to hire a Sr. Web Application Developer to work in our Toronto, Canada office.

This is a permanent relocation opportunity to relocate to Canada.

In-house, licensed Immigration team at Flynn who will assist you with the following:

  • Work permit application (at no cost to you)
  • Permits for your spouse/common-law partner and dependent children to relocate with you to Canada
  • Maintaining and renewing your status in Canada without having to leave the country
  • Permanent residency application for you and your family once you qualify

How We Will Help You Grow

  • 3 months accommodation
  • Reimbursement for your flight to Canada
  • Health Insurance and Prescription Drug Plan for you and your family
  • Dental and vision plans
  • Registered Retirement Savings Plan (RRSP) contributions
  • Extensive safety training, state of the art equipment, and cutting edge technology that will allow you to work in a safe & healthy environment

Our Tech Stack

Our primary tech stack is .NET (C#) hosted in Amazon AWS and Microsoft Azure. We use MongoDB, MySQL, and SQL Server for our databases. Apps are built in ASP.NET and Angular for our web apps and a mix of Java, Swift, and Xamarin for our mobile apps.

Responsibilities
  • Will be a core member of the team to design, architect, develop, code reviews and test our key applications
  • Design new application features and integrations in collaboration with team members to deliver complex changes
  • Design and implement scalable and resilient cloud solutions with security and disaster recovery in mind
  • Help the team plan and execute technical deliverables
  • Ensure good code coverage and test coverage by writing and maintaining effective automated tests
  • Be a champion of code quality in team by adhering to CLEAN architecture and SOLID principles
  • Mentor other developers on the team in software development life cycle and best practices and elevate the skill of the team through technical mentorship
  • Work with BA team and stakeholders to identify business needs and develop solutions that align with their objectives
  • Off-hours support as required
  • Participate in a rotating weekly on-call schedule
What we are Seeking
  • 10+ years of recent experience, with at least 5 years in a Sr. Web Developer or similar senior role
  • Post-secondary education in Computer Science/IT or related field
  • Experience in .NET / .NET Framework and C#
  • Experience in entity framework
  • Experience with TypeScript front-end frameworks: Angular, React, Vue
  • Experience with commonly used relational database: MySQL, SQL Server, Postgres
  • Experience with commonly used non-relational databases: MongoDB, DocumentDB, DynamoDB
  • Docker and container-hosting: AWS ECS, Kubernetes
  • General Amazon AWS knowledge (or equivalent): EC2, S3, CloudFront, Elastic Beanstalk, Dynamo DB
  • Basic networking knowledge and troubleshooting
  • Experience with any of the following tools and technologies: Jira, GitHub, Azure DevOps, Aha!, New Relic, Sumo Logic
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.